Abstract
The utility model discloses a kind of charging device for correcting for freezing equipment conveyer belt, and including the Transfer pipe above conveyer belt, the width of the Transfer pipe leading portion is gradually reduced along the direction of advance of the conveyer belt;Sensor is arranged in the exit of the Transfer pipe, and the sensor is connected with computer control by conducting wire;The sensor, which has detected, to be needed to send signal to the computer control when chilled meat passes through on conveyer belt, the computer control will be executed instruction to first power device and second power device transmission respectively after the signal processing received, controlling the first power device falls before baffler, decline after controlling the second power device and making stripper plate, squeeze and gather operation, realizes specification charging.Meat to be frozen on the utility model energy automatic separation conveyer belt, and carry out gathering shaping, do not have to manual operation, safety and sanitation can also be added in automatic production line, save manpower, improve working efficiency.

Background technique
The meat that food processing factory completes the process will pass through freezing processing, facilitate preservation.Freezing link is using biography at present
Send band refrigerating plant.If meat moisture is excessively loose too much, finished product meat shape is bad after will lead to freezing processing, influences to pack
Effect, and a large amount of meat put stack mutually on a moving belt it is disorderly and unsystematic.Food processing factory needs manually passing at present
It send and takes that completion charging specification is put and re-shaping exercise is gathered in pressing, remove moisture extra in meat, heavy workload, multiplicity
Height, artificial directly contact, which is processed meat, may also generate the hygienic issues such as meat pollution;Automation cannot be especially inserted in
On production line, the purpose of personnel reduction and enlargement cannot achieve.

Specific embodiment
As shown in Figure 1, a kind of charging device for correcting for freezing equipment conveyer belt of the present invention, including conveyer belt 1, it is described
Multiple separators 3 are arranged in the top of conveyer belt 1, and the separator 3 is separated out multiple be parallel to each other in the top of the conveyer belt 1
Transfer pipe 2;The width of 2 leading portion of Transfer pipe is gradually reduced along the direction of advance of the conveyer belt 1.
Sensor 6 is arranged in the exit of the Transfer pipe 2, and the sensor 6 passes through conducting wire with computer control 11
It is connected.The sensor 6 is photoelectric sensor or infrared sensor.
As shown in Figure 1 and Figure 2, the exit of each Transfer pipe 2 is additionally provided with baffler 8 and stripper plate 7;It is described
Baffler 8 is vertical with the feed direction of the conveyer belt 1;The baffler 8 is connected to first by the first telescoping mechanism 12 and moves
On power device 10, first power device 10 drives the baffler 8 to move up and down by first telescoping mechanism 12.
The stripper plate 7 is parallel with the conveyer belt 1, and the setting of the stripper plate 7 is close above the baffler 8
The side of 1 import of conveyer belt;The stripper plate 7 is connected in the second power device 9 by the second telescoping mechanism 13, described
Second power device 9 drives the stripper plate 7 to move up and down by second telescoping mechanism 13.
First power device 10 and second power device 9 pass through conducting wire and 11 phase of computer control
Even;The computer control 11 is MSP430 single-chip microcontroller.
The sensor 6, which has detected, to be needed to be sent when chilled meat 4 passes through to the computer control 11 on conveyer belt 1
Signal, the computer control 11 by after the signal processing received respectively to first power device 10 and described second
The transmission of power device 9 executes instruction.
As shown in Figure 1, be separated out parallel Transfer pipe 2 with separator 3 on conveyer belt 1, quantity can be according to using need
It adjusts, separator 2 is broadened along 1 direction of advance of conveyer belt (direction as shown by the arrows in Figure 1) by narrow, makes the Transfer pipe 2
The width of leading portion is gradually reduced along the direction of advance of the conveyer belt 1;Sensor 6, institute is arranged in the exit of the Transfer pipe 2
Sensor 6 is stated to be connected with computer control 11 by conducting wire;When meat 4 to be frozen passes through photoelectric sensor 6, output signal.
As shown in Fig. 2, signal is exported to computer control 11, controlling the first power device 10 falls before baffler 8,
Decline after controlling the second power device 9 and making stripper plate 7, squeeze and gather operation, realizes that the specification for treating chilled meat 4 is fed.
The present invention is suitable for multiple meat, especially flesh of fish block.
